The science of biochar production relies on the technical process of pyrolysis. This chemical reaction occurs in a low-oxygen and high-temperature environment. The equipment converts wood chips, straw, and bamboo into useful materials. High heat breaks down the biomass without traditional combustion. This method produces biochar, syngas, and wood vinegar. Syngas acts as a clean fuel for industrial heating within the plant. This energy loop makes biochar production self-sustaining and efficient. Pyrolysis avoids the generation of harmful smoke and hazardous gases. Precise thermal control optimizes biochar production for specific moisture profiles. Mingjie Group offers the MJT-100 portable small carbonization equipment for specialized projects. This skid-mounted biomass carbonization equipment supports continuous operation. It serves as an excellent verification machine for new biochar production ventures. The MJT-100 design handles materials between 5mm and 20mm in size. It processes dry bamboo chips, rice husks, and nut shells effectively. This equipment requires raw materials with less than 15% water content. Users benefit from easy installation and a small footprint. This solution provides high cost-effectiveness for small-scale biochar production. The machine also processes coffee shells and palm shells with ease. Small-scale projects can achieve professional results with this compact design. Large enterprises require the fully automatic wood charcoal manufacturing machine. This system handles massive volumes for industrial biochar production. The machine processes 30 to 50 tons of bamboo chips daily. Large materials over 20mm require pre-treatment with shredders. The system also utilizes dryers for moisture content up to 65%. Fully automatic machines feature continuous feeding and discharging for 24 hours. A water-cooled automatic slag discharge system enables high-temperature discharge. This feature eliminates downtime and prevents fly ash during biochar production. Such technical features maintain a clean and safe operating environment. Pyrolysis offers significant advantages over direct biomass incineration. The process produces far fewer dioxins and harmful NOx emissions. It also limits the release of SO2 into the air. Syngas from biochar production has higher energy value than gasification products. Incineration simply destroys waste without recovering its chemical energy. Pyrolysis transforms waste into a stable carbon resource instead. This method promotes carbon circulation within the local ecosystem. It protects the atmosphere while recovering energy and materials. Advanced biochar production effectively reduces the volume and weight of garbage. This reduction minimizes the need for expansive landfill space. Pyrolysis represents a much cleaner path for waste-to-energy projects.
